South Boston: A Growing Hub for Nursing Opportunities Amidst Southern Charm and Community Spirit

Nestled along the banks of the Dan River in the heart of Southern Virginia, South Boston is a charming small town steeped in rich history and community spirit. Known for its warm Southern hospitality, the city offers a welcoming atmosphere to both residents and visitors. Here in South Boston, we enjoy an idyllic pace of life surrounded by picturesque landscapes. The nursing job market here is robust, bolstered by a mix of long-standing healthcare facilities and a growing demand for services.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the average annual salary for nurses in Virginia is approximately $77,730, with a median of $70,030, equating to roughly $37.31 per hour statewide. Locally, in South Boston, I would estimate that the average salary for nurses ranges from $65,000 to $75,000 per year given the cost of living and the community's specific needs. South Boston also has a unique charm with local landmarks such as the South Boston-Halifax County Museum and the lovely downtown area that showcases quaint shops and dining options, which add to the city's appeal.

As we delve deeper into the nursing job market in South Boston, current trends indicate a strong and growing need for nursing professionals. The NurseRecruiter estimates that the city will require approximately 150 new nurses over the next five years due to the increasing demand for healthcare services, particularly as our city’s population steadily grows. With an existing healthcare workforce of around 400 employed nurses in South Boston, we find ourselves in a transitional phase where new opportunities are emerging daily. Travel nursing jobs are gradually gaining traction, especially during peak seasons like summer when demands increase for short-term staffing at local facilities. Additionally, I estimate that there are around 50 per diem nursing jobs available, which caters to both flexibility for nurses and the fluctuating healthcare demands of our community. When comparing South Boston with nearby cities like Danville and Lynchburg, we see a noticeable difference in salary ranges and opportunities. Danville may offer slightly higher salaries due to its larger healthcare institutions, whereas our low cost of living in South Boston provides unique benefits for nurses seeking a balanced lifestyle.

Our healthcare infrastructure is marked by several key facilities, including Sentara Halifax Regional Hospital, which services a considerable portion of the local population. The hospital offers a range of specialties, such as critical care and maternity, reflecting the diverse needs of our community. With ongoing investments and the development of telehealth solutions, South Boston is making strides in modernizing its healthcare delivery, allowing for greater access and efficiency in care. The city itself is home to about 8,500 residents, reflecting a consistent growth trend in recent years that supports our community's need for nursing professionals. Public health initiatives, focusing on maternal and child health, as well as chronic disease management, also present further opportunities for nurses to engage meaningfully with our population.
